Radio
The GPPN contributed to and faciliated a number of radio programmes focusing on water issues at the 17th session of the UN Commission on Sustainable Development, as part of Stakeholder Forum's 'Live at the CSD' radio project. You can listen to the programmes below:
Earth Talk, Episode 6
At the 17th session of the Commission on Sustainable Development, the Global Public Policy Network was co-ordinating advocacy around water as a cross-cutting issue. Here Armando Canchanya checks in with Hannah Stoddart from the GPPN Secretariat, and Lesha Witmer from the Women for Water Partnership to discuss why water underpins all the other themes under discussion.
Greentables Episode 4: Watering down the issues?
Water, consumption, international law and human rights are under discussion during this Greentable, where Hannah Stoddart is joined by environmental lawyer Randy Christensen from Canadian NGO Ecojustice, Danish Sustainable Development Ambassador Aagaard Andersen, and Olcay Ünver, Coordinator of the United Nations World Water Assessment Programme. Discussions focus on water's role for sustainable development, how to manage water scarcity, and how the human right to water interacts with water as an economic good.
